yar, a Nova, 21 years old! not that much is left thats that old. Lots of work done underneath, coilover suspension, 300mm brakes, strengthened wishbones, lowered track control arms, uprated anti roll bars, rally spec driveshafts and hubs, etc. Engine is from the calibra turbo with some mods including a 9 litre intercooler.
